North of Australia with dense forests​

Geography
1 answer:
expeople1 [14]1 year ago
6 0

Answer: Coordinates: 16°12′S 145°24′E The Daintree Rainforest

Explanation: This is a region on the northeast coast of Queensland, Australia, north of Mossman and Cairns.

Scientists are able to determine the relative age of rocks in specific years.<br> True or false
photoshop1234 [79]
It is false that scientists are able to determine the relative age of rocks in specific years. This is because relative age refers to how much <span>one layer is older or younger than another layer but does not indicate the rock's age in years, but perhaps in centuries at most. Scientists can, however, determine the absolute age of rocks using radiometric dating. </span>
